Chemistry [CHM] (Major)
The chemistry major provides a solid foundation in chemistry, physics and mathematics. Students in this major can pursue many career pathways including employment, government positions or electing to continue their studies in a wide variety of graduate programs.
Career Potential
- Industrial Chemist
- Health professions
- Research scientist
- Consultant
- Patent Attorney
- State and Federal Agency scientist and policy maker
In addition to the course requirements listed below, students must take five additional credit hours in chemistry at the 300 level or above, excluding CHE 305 and CHE 306.
Students who fulfill this requirement in part by taking 2 cr. hrs. of CHE 480 - Independent Research, fulfill the requirements for the American Chemical Society approved major in Chemistry.
- CHE 221 - General Chemistry I (4 cr. hr.)
- CHE 222 - General Chemistry II (4 cr. hr.)
- CHE 301 - Organic Chemistry I (4 cr. hr.)
- CHE 302 - Organic Chemistry II (3 cr. hr.)
- CHE 304 - Organic Chemistry Laboratory II (1 cr. hr.)
- CHE 310 - Foundations of Analytical Chemistry (4 cr. hr.)
- CHE 340 - Inorganic Chemistry (3 cr. hr.)
- CHE 361 - Introduction to Research in Chemistry and Biochemistry (1 cr. hr.)
- CHE 431 - Physical Chemistry I (3 cr. hr.)
- CHE 432 - Physical Chemistry II (3 cr. hr.)
- CHE 451 - Introductory Biochemistry I (3 cr. hr.)
- CHE 461 - Senior Seminar in Chemistry and Biochemistry (1 cr. hr.)
- CHE 477 - Advanced Laboratory I (3 cr. hr.)
- CHE 478 - Advanced Laboratory II (3 cr. hr.)
- MAT 121 - Calculus A (3 cr. hr.) and
- MAT 122 - Calculus B (3 cr. hr.)
or - MAT 135 - Calculus I (4 cr. hr.) and
- MAT 236 - Calculus II (4 cr. hr.)
Plus
One additional math course at the 200 level or higher, selected in consultation with advisor. Appropriate courses would include MAT 224, MAT 237, MAT 272 and MAT 430.
Plus- PHY 201 - Principles of Physics I (4 cr. hr.)
- PHY 202 - Principles of Physics II (4 cr. hr.)
- 59-62 credit hours of General Education requirements and free electives
